Re: Recall pen
Just build a Johnny House that way you can easily customize it they way you want to and I'd say you probably should have done so before you picked up the quail, I like to make mine fly up to feed drink and look outside and I also keep the cocks separated from the Hens this time of year, other wise they might try and pair up and take off, right now I only let the cocks out for training and leave the hens in.
Re: Recall pen
I second the recomendation on a Johny House. Wire and ledge around the top so birds fly up to see out. This gives your birds plenty of exersize, My first quail pen was similar to what LCS shows, I had to let my birds out several times a week and flush them so they would get some excersize, with a johny house that is not needed and your birds will be strong flyers.

Re: Recall pen
The quail will not recall 2 miles back to your jonny house at home. What ever you call them back into has to be within hearing distance of the calling bird in the recall pen( keep your best calling bird to be put in the recall cage---if you don't have a bird that calls in your cage, they won't come back!!)mudpuppy1299 wrote:I have been contemplating whether to build a johnny house or use a recall pen as well. Re: Recall pen
I have an old creative sports supply call back cage. It works well. Its about the same as the LCS call back.
If your going to leave it out overnight then you will want to stake it down and make sure any doors latch really well. I put a little food bowl in the corner as an extra enticement. You can also put a temporary fence up around it with 2"x 4" mesh to try and deter predators, northern bobs can squeeze right thru.

Re: Recall pen
I've had good luck with a Johnny house but I let the birds fly out of it instead of releasing them I start letting some of them out everyday for a week before I mess with them, by 2 weeks they are getting out some distance, also if you let them out in the afternoon they are likely to spend the night out and lose a few, they seem to be a delicacy to cats
